I have two KL42H2150-42-8A Nema 42 2830oz-in step motors running the gantry on this 5 axis machine: http://www.cnczone.com/forums/plasma...a_10x5x24.html The motors are vibrating quite a bit and I cannot tune them to be smooth enough. I have tuned them using the trimpot on the Gecko 203V's & can get them pretty quiet at ~0.5rev/sec, but not silent & at some rpm they are really noisy. I am using Gecko 203V's at 6amps for drivers & 72V (KL7220) power supply. Is there some other way I can tune them to run more smoothly?
I have it running on Pacific Bearing 25mm Profile Rail, could this have anything to do with it if it were in need of grease?
They are 8 wire motors & I have them wired Bi-polar parallel, will a different wiring run more smoothly? Lower voltage? Seems to be vibrating way too much.
I spoke with Keling & they are sure that it's not the motors as they have sold hundreds of them & have not had any problems + they say because it's both motors doing the same thing, it's most likely some other mechanical issue. Any ideas anyone? Thanks in advanace.
